Turkish Game Marred by Controversy as Galatasaray Opponents Storm Off

web editor  

The Adana Demirspor players made a dramatic exit from the pitch during the first-half of their match against Super Lig leaders Galatasaray on Sunday. According to Turkey's state news agency, the players walked off in protest after a penalty was awarded against them, resulting in Galatasaray taking a 1-0 lead with Alvaro Morata scoring from the spot in the 30th minute. Following their departure, the referee's team attempted to speak with them in the dressing room, leading to an announcement that the match at Rams Park stadium had been abandoned.

Turkish media reports said the team, who are bottom of the table, had stormed off in protest over what they claimed was "referee corruption".
